India Health Action Trust was instituted in 2003 as a Charitable Trust with a vision to meaningfully impact the lives of vulnerable and marginalised people by addressing health and social inequities. The Trust is working towards reducing inequities by developing comprehensive and sustainable programmes to improve population health. Since its inception, IHAT has been working closely with the Government of India and state governments, including Uttar Pradesh, Madhya Pradesh, Bihar, Rajasthan, Delhi and Maharashtra to achieve public health goals. Our work is focused in areas of prevention and control of HIV and Tuberculosis, in achieving significant improvements in Reproductive, Maternal, Neonatal and Child Health, improved Nutrition among mothers and children, and strengthening health systems. We use program science to optimise and scale public health programs while partnering with the governments and communities.

India Health Action Trust (IHAT) is providing Technical support to the UP State TB programme in the area of Diagnostic Network Optimization, Integration of TB in Primary Health Care, Private Sector Engagement and also in the Multisector Engagement. IHAT has received a research grant from Azim Premji Foundation (APF) to conduct a qualitative study titled “The Intersection of Tuberculosis, Menstrual Health, and Mental Well-being Among Adolescent Girls in Selected District of Uttar Pradesh””. To support the implementation of this study, IHAT is recruiting two Field Investigators who will be based in in the study district. These Field Investigators will be the bridge between the study and the respondents.
To conduct high-quality qualitative data collection through interviews, focus group discussions (FGDs), observations, and documentation while ensuring ethical engagement with adolescent participants and maintaining data quality standards. The Field Investigator will support implementation of field activities under the direct supervision of the Research Associate and will be primarily responsible for participant recruitment, qualitative data collection, documentation, and field-level coordination.
